About Almholme, South Yorkshire

Almholme emerges from the flat, expansive lowlands of South Yorkshire as a quiet collection of dwellings defined by the wide, open sky above. It lies 2.0 miles north-east of Bentley (from Bentley: bearing 48°T, OS grid SE 590 080), and is situated north-east of Arksey village. The horizon here is vast and unencumbered, drawing the eye toward the distant, shimmering reeds of Thorpe Marsh where the air feels heavy with the scent of damp earth and river silt. Water dictates the character of the land, as the Bentley and Arksey Commons Drain carves a deliberate path through the fields to keep the heavy soil productive. Beyond the immediate boundaries of the houses, the terrain stays stubbornly level, mirroring the slow, deliberate pace of the water moving through the nearby Hurst Pit Drain. Light hits these low-lying pastures with a startling clarity, bleaching the grass in summer and turning the winter furrows into deep, bruised ribbons of shadow. Almholme maintains a stoic independence, existing as a thin line of habitation between the encroaching marshland and the rigorous geometry of modern agriculture. The silence of the fields remains absolute, broken only by the sudden, sharp call of a lapwing rising above the drainage channels.
